Locchi has a stock in Florence and in Florence, one in Perugia, Città di Castello, Magione and Umbertide in Perugia and one in Rome, Locco, very rare, typical of the Cosenza area, of Bisignano in particular, could derive from an apheretic form usual of the term allocco (sort of nocturnal bird), used as a nickname to indicate a particular clumsiness, or even as a name in medieval times, less probable, but still possible a derivation from the archaic term locco (dense syrup to the licorice that was prescribed to throat sufferers).
